Rupee breaches 40-mark

MUMBAI: The rupee lost 10 paise against the dollar on Wednesday and breached the crucial 40 level for the first time in two weeks at 40.05/06 on heavy demand for dollar from oil refiners following crude prices touching record levels. The rupee closed at 39.95/96 on Tuesday.

In wide movements at the interbank foreign exchange market, the rupee moved in a range of 40.09 and 39.90 after resuming steady at Tuesday’s closing level 39.95/96 a dollar. In overseas markets, the dollar dropped to a new low against the euro on Tuesday. — PTI
